Community Volunteers Serve Together

Close to 95 families (almost 400 people) gathered at The Weber School on January 18 for the 2nd Annual Family Mitzvah Day, a JF&CS Volunteer initiative that brings families together to serve, connect, and have fun! The event featured more than 50 high school student volunteers, and our generous community partners, all working side by side in the spirit of service.

In just its second year, Family Mitzvah Day “has already grown so much!” said event organizer Megan Koziel, LMSW, Volunteer Engagement Manager. “It’s a reminder of how impactful it is to create space for people to give back together.”

The enthusiasm in the room was palpable, as excited parents and kids got to choose their favorite Mitzvah projects. Some projects met tangible needs, some were full of heart, and all celebrated community. A pop-up coffee shop, treats and snacks rounded out the experience.

“This is SO MUCH FUN!” exclaimed one young attendee, a sentiment that was echoed many times throughout the day.


All in all, participants made:

200 soup jars

400 hygiene kits

100 senior care bags

7 art pieces

300 sensory kits

65 lap blankets

80+ birthday cake kits

100+ birthday cards

100 therapeutic comfort packs

100+ beaded bracelets

Families also donated and sorted books with PJ Library, sorted waste with Adamah ATL, learned about Dr. MLK Jr. with Repair the World, made hundreds of keychains for Israeli soldiers with the Schoenbaum Shinshinim, and created slime with the JF&CS Horwitz-Zusman Child & Family Center.

“It was meaningful to see families and volunteers finding joy and connection through service,” said Megan. “We’re incredibly grateful to the families, sponsors, and partners that made the day possible.”
